  Word Descriptions reactionary, optional, meek, heedless, invulnerable, submissive, pendulous, theoretical, eclectic, indocile


   
Description of reactionary (adjective: more reactionary; most reactionary)
extremely conservative; far-right



   
Description of optional (adjective)
possible but not necessary



   
Description of meek (adjective: meeker; meekest)
evidencing little spirit or courage



   
Description of heedless (adjective)
characterized by careless unconcern



   
Description of invulnerable (adjective)
immune to attack



   
Description of submissive (adjective)
obedient; meek, compliant, yielding



   
Description of pendulous (adjective)
swinging; hanging loosely



   
Description of theoretical (adjective)
concerned with theories rather than their practical applications



   
Description of eclectic (adjective)
selecting what seems best of various styles or ideas



   
Description of indocile (adjective)
of persons; ungovernable; unruly
